Transaction 00ffa965cbaf35f7014944fb1880dc6c03bbcdf1b531bfda62f9082324dbd5dc

18 Input
2 Outputs
  • 00ffa965cbaf35f7014944fb1880dc6c03bbcdf1b531bfda62f9082324dbd5dc:0
  • value  398493630
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 00ffa965cbaf35f7014944fb1880dc6c03bbcdf1b531bfda62f9082324dbd5dc:1
  • value  1953588
    address  38V2s1xYSmYRiRBdGu4szRheR6d5y4VDVt